Very small and simple library to do Functional Reactive Programming in Ruby in a similar way to Elm.
Add this line to your application's Gemfile:
gem 'frypan'
And then execute:
$ bundle
Or install it yourself as:
$ gem install frypan
To experience FRP and understand how to use this library, we make an imitation of Linux's atd(8) and at(1).
